Case Summary

Pauls Creamery Pvt. Ltd and Seawood Homes(India) Pvt. Ltd are involved in a legal dispute regarding an injunction. The defendant seeks to refer the matter to arbitration based on an arbitration clause in their agreement.

Interim Order
The court has decided to allow the petition for arbitration, stating that the dispute should be referred to arbitration based on the existing agreement between the parties.
